Letters from Welsh emigrants in America

  • NLW MS 17441i-iiE.
  • File
  • 1846-1955

Two groups of letters from Welsh emigrants to America, 1846-1847, 1870-1878, together with letters relating to emigration from Wales, 1948-1955.

Llythyrau o Racine, Wisconsin

Dau lythyr, 1846-1847, oddi wrth John ac Isaac Cheshire, Racine, Wisconsin, ymfydwyr o Gymru, at eu llystad a'u mam Morris a [Sarah] Davies, Trefonen, sir Amwythig. = Two letters, 1846-1847, from John and Isaac Cheshire, Racine, Wisconsin, Welsh emigrants, to their stepfather and mother, Morris and [Sarah] Davies, Trefonen, Shropshire.
Cynhwysir hefyd dau lythyr oddi wrth y rhoddwyr, y Merched M. A. a C. F. Davies, at Alan Conway, 1955 (ff. 5-6, Saesneg). = Also included are two letters from the donors, the Misses M. A. and C. F. Davies, to Alan Conway, 1955 (ff. 5-6, English).

Letters from Providence, Pennsylvania.

Six holograph letters, 1870-1878, from the brothers Samuel, David and William Morgan, Providence, Pennsylvania, to their family in South Wales (ff. 1-12), along with five letters, 1948-1949, to Charlotte Erickson relating to emigration from Wales, apparently sent in response to an appeal in the Western Mail (ff. 13-19).
Also included is a typescript copy by Erickson, [1949], of a 1925 letter from Alfred A. Jones, Salt Lake City, Utah (f. 18).
